Rudy Gay impresses in home debut with the Kings – 26 points 5 rebounds and 4 steals

Rudy Gay had an impressive home debut with the Kings on Sunday, scoring 26 points, grabbing 5 boards and dishing out 4 assists while coming away with 4 steals.   The royal night ended with a hug from DeMarcus Cousins and a standing ovation from the crowd as he walked to the bench near the end of a 106-91 victory over the Houston Rockets.

His 26 point game last night and Kings debut of 24 points on Friday marked the only two games this season that Gay has scored over 20 points  while making 50% of his shots.  He was averaging 20 points a game while shooting 40% in Toronto.

With the underrated Isaiah Thomas at point, arguably the most talented big man in the league at center, impressive rookie McLemore, and new additions Derrick Williams and Rudy Gay, the Kings could turn into a very scary team in the very near future.
